Election Tuesday By BARRY BURLESON Editor The
Republican Primary for the U.S. House of Representatives 1st
Congressional District will be held next Tuesday, June 1. Polls will be open from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. Three Republicans are seeking their party’s nomination next week – Angela McGlowan, Alan Nunnelee and Henry Ross. The
winner will face Democratic incumbent Travis Childers in the general
election in November, along with Gail Giaranita of the Constitution
Party, Harold Taylor (Libertarian), Barbara Dale Washer (Reform), and
Independents A.G. Baddley, Les Green, Rick “Rico” Hoskins and Wally Pang The
deadline for registering to vote in the Republican Primary has already
passed, but citizens can register to vote at any time during regular
office hours at the circuit clerk’s office at the Marshall County
Courthouse. Absentee voting for the June 1
primary is available now in person at the circuit clerk’s office, which
will be open for absentee balloting on Saturday, May 29, from 8 a.m. to
12 noon. Call the Marshall County circuit clerk’s office at 662-252-3434 for any other election information. NOTICE
– Due to an emergency situation, voting in the 5 South Holly Springs
Precinct (National Guard Armory) for the Republican Primary Election
next Tuesday, June 1, will be held at the Shriners Building located at
957 Highway 4 East in Holly Springs.
